Jack each rear tire under the connection for the lca's and put your jack stands at the jack points in front of the rear tires. Once the rear is up, jack the front from the center where the lca's come together. Use jack stands on jack points behind front tires. I have to drive my front tires up onto 2x10's so the jack will fit under the center.
